Space and facilities
Our purpose-built, flexible spaces in sbarc|spark, offer everything from hot-desking and meeting rooms to high-spec wet labs. Spanning over 22,000 square feet across three floors, Cardiff Innovations provides:
- Fully serviced offices (226–1,163 square feet)
- Co-working and hot-desking space (4,800 square feet)
- Wet labs with fume cupboards (4,240 square feet)
- Co-working space for student and graduate entrepreneurs
- High-spec formal and informal meeting rooms
- Event space accommodating up to 100 attendees
- Collaboration zones, breakout areas, kitchenettes and onsite Café
- High-speed broadband via external provider
- Central and Cardiff Innovations reception services
- Preferential access to university services and facilities
- Connections to wider university experts and trusted professional advisors
The sbarc|spark building is a holistic community of academics, businesses, public sector, third sector, and student entrepreneurs.
It is also home to, SPARK, the world’s first Social Science Research Park. It brings together over 15 research centres and more than 15 partner organisations to tackle major societal challenges – from climate change and social care to the future of the economy and digital transformation. By combining Cardiff University’s world-leading social science expertise with industry, public and third sector partners, SPARK is creating new knowledge, solutions and impact for a wiser, fairer society.
sbarc|spark is located within the University’s Innovation Campus which includes, CUBRIC, Hadyn Ellis, and Translational Research Hub.
Events and networking opportunities
At Cardiff Innovations, we actively support the growth of businesses through a variety of events, networking opportunities, and industry connections. We host events that encourage networking and foster collaboration, knowledge exchange, and business development.
Cardiff Innovations tenants become members of the Cardiff University Innovation Network (CUIN) — a bridge between academia and industry, unlocking the potential of ideas through vibrant collaborations. Members are invited to free events throughout the year on innovation, enterprise and entrepreneurship.
Cardiff University is also a member of SETsquared, an inspiring enterprise partnership between six leading research-led UK universities: Bath, Bristol, Cardiff, Exeter, Southampton and Surrey. As part of the partnership, Cardiff Innovations tenants can exclusively apply to participate in annual investor and corporate engagement events organised by SETsquared.
